android服务在一个单独的线程中?

标签 android multithreading service android-activity

我在同一个包中有一个主 Activity 类A和一个服务类S,我在启动A时就启动了S。我的问题是:S的运行时内存是否算作A的一部分?如果我强制停止 A,我是否也停止 S?谢谢

最佳答案

参见 here .

默认情况下,应用程序的所有组件都在同一个线程中执行,但您可以使用 list 文件中的 android:process 属性更改此行为。

关于android服务在一个单独的线程中?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6014369/

相关文章:

c - 多线程应用程序中的段错误和不正确的输出

python - Celery Worker 中的多线程

android - 使用 Otto 从 GcmListenerService 刷新列表适配器

java - Android:访问安全的 xml 文件

android - 拥有多个 Launcher Activity

java - 使用 JAXB 时如何避免 Android 上的 StAX API 错误?

android - 使用动画时音频线程运行缓慢

android - sqlite数据库插入重复数据

c++ - 高效地分配许多短命的小对象

javascript - 从 WCF 服务的 bool 方法接收答案